Imagine that two linear equations form a system. You elect to solve the system by graphing. What are the three situations that may occur in discovering the solution to the system? Discuss each possibility and what it looks like graphically.

Answers

Answer:

They could be the same line, they could cross at one point, or they could be parallel.

Explanation:

1) The equations could be the same line. When you graph them they could overlap, have exactly the same slope and y-intercept, and be the same line.

2) They could cross at one point. This could look like an X, be perpendicular, or anything that had the two lines cross. Then you could solve for that point.

3) The lines could be parallel. This would mean they would have the same slope, but different x and y intercepts. If two lines are parallel, they do not intersect.

The white-tailed ptarmigan lives at high elevations on mountains that receive a lot of snow in the winter. During the summer, the ptarmigans’ feathers are mottled brown. The birds lose the brown feathers and grow a new set of white feathers during the winter. Scientists are concerned that rising global temperatures will affect the white-tailed ptarmigan. If global climate change leads to the elimination of snow in the habitat of white-tailed ptarmigans, which adaptation is most likely to occur over many generations? A.Birds with white feathers in areas without winter snow will be easier for predators to find. Over time this could lead to white-tailed ptarmigans that have brown feathers throughout the year. B.Birds with brown feathers in areas without winter snow will be easier for predators to find. Over time this could lead to white-tailed ptarmigans that have white feathers throughout the year. C.Birds with white feathers will be easier to see on the ground in the summer. Over time this could lead to white-tailed ptarmigans that have white feathers throughout the year. D.Birds with brown feathers will be easier to see on the ground in the winter. Over time this could lead to white-tailed ptarmigans that have brown feathers throughout the year.

Answers

Answer:

A.) .Birds with white feathers in areas without winter snow will be easier for predators to find. Over time this could lead to white-tailed ptarmigans that have brown feathers throughout the year.

Explanation: This seems to make the most sense. The birds with the Brown feathers are more likely to survive and reproduce so they will pass the trait of retaining Brown feathers year round to their offspring. This is likely to continue as long as there is no snow in the winter environment.
